This etching by Alec Grieve showcases the exquisite beauty of Leuchars Church's Norman Apse. Measuring 35.3x25 cm, this print is a true testament to Grieve's artistic talent and attention to detail. The McManus in Dundee, UK proudly houses this remarkable piece. Grieve skillfully captures the essence of Leuchars Church, with its stunning architecture and intricate design elements. The Romanesque arches and towers stand tall against the Scottish sky, evoking a sense of grandeur and history. The medieval charm of St Athernase Church in Fife is also subtly referenced within this artwork. The etching brings to life the unique features of the church's apse, highlighting its significance as an architectural masterpiece.
